- Walter was always seeking revenge for that first victory Max took from him, and Max was looking to emulate his moment of glory.†

Definitions:
-
(1)
(emulate) imitate (copy or match)
-
(2)
(meaning too rare to warrant focus) meaning too rare to warrant focus:
Much more rarely, emulate can mean to try to reach equality is some sense -- as in "This artists' drawings cannot emulate his water colors."
